A fine, wood-aged wine from the Dão's star white grape, it gives yellow fruit tones of apricot and peach, with toast and lees flavors providing a rich, full-bodied structure. The acidity cuts right through the palate, bringing out a lively, fresh aftertaste. Drink now, but the wine will be better in 2015.
